Slightly better work around:
mc.mcCntlGcodeExecuteWait(inst, "G1 X10 Y10 F450")
mc.mcCntlGcodeExecute(inst, "G1 X-10 Y-10 F450")
This will perform the rapids as expected.
Caveat: Running above code from the LUA editor, if the motion is stopped with the on-screen stop button, no amount of coaxing would make it run again short of closing and reopening MACH4. Might work better saved as a proper macro. I stopped messing with it at the above work around.
